Abstract

An anti-tampering device and method to inhibit or prevent unauthorized probing of an electronic circuit. Propriety target circuitry transmits a distinct signature in the form of an RF signal which is received by the RF anti-tampering detection circuitry. The transmitted RF signature is monitored by the RF anti-tampering detection circuitry for user-defined changes. In the event an unauthorized attempt is made to probe the target system electronics, the mass of the probe alters the RF transmission characteristics of the RF transmission media, changing the RF signature. The altered RF signature is received by the receiving antenna and RF receiver and is processed by signal processing electronics. The change in the RF signature indicates a tamper event and a predefined anti-tamper event is generated.

Claims (18)

1 . An electronic device comprising:

a proprietary circuit having an operational RF signature,

an RF anti-tampering detection circuit comprising RF receiver means for receiving the operational RF signature, and,

signal processing means for detecting a predetermined change in the received operational RF signature.

The device of claim 1 further comprising means for generating a predetermined anti-tamper event when the predetermined change in the received operational signature is detected.

The device of claim 2 wherein the predetermined anti-tamper event comprises erasing the contents of an electronic memory.

The device of claim 2 wherein the predetermined anti-tamper event comprises disabling a circuit element by means of an over-current protection device.

The device of claim 2 wherein the predetermined anti-tamper event comprises the reconfiguration of an I/O in a field programmable gate array.

The device of claim 2 wherein the predetermined anti-tamper event comprises the opening of an electronic switch.

The device of claim 2 wherein the predetermined response comprises logically reconfiguring a first connection point in the proprietary target circuitry to a second connection point in the proprietary target circuitry.

The device of claim 2 further comprising an electronic enclosure having a predetermined enclosure RF signal.

The device of claim 2 wherein the RF anti-tampering detection circuitry further comprises synchronous demodulator clock means.

The device of claim 2 wherein the RF anti-tampering detection circuitry further comprises RF transmitter means.

The device of claim 2 further comprising dedicated RF signature transmitting means.

A method for inhibiting or preventing an attempt to analyze a proprietary circuit comprising the steps of:

receiving the RF signature of a proprietary circuit,

monitoring the RF signature to detect a predetermined change in the RF signature,

generating a predetermined anti-tamper event when the predetermined change is detected.
